DRILL-1476: Clear  transfer pair list when in Limit when schema changes

Project: http://git-wip-us.apache.org/repos/asf/incubator-drill/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-drill/commit/37138810
Tree: http://git-wip-us.apache.org/repos/asf/incubator-drill/tree/37138810
Diff: http://git-wip-us.apache.org/repos/asf/incubator-drill/diff/37138810

Branch: refs/heads/master
Commit: 37138810418c25dc455d5fc6c30b33cb612c4c50
Parents: d8edf63
Author: Steven Phillips <[email protected]>
Authored: Tue Sep 30 18:17:23 2014 -0700
Committer: Steven Phillips <[email protected]>
Committed: Tue Sep 30 18:17:23 2014 -0700

----------------------------------------------------------------------
 .../org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java | 1 +
 1 file changed, 1 insertion(+)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-drill/blob/37138810/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java
----------------------------------------------------------------------
diff --git 
a/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java
 
b/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java
index 8f4d90f..8ffd7be 100644
--- 
a/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java
+++ 
b/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/limit/LimitRecordBatch.java
@@ -60,6 +60,7 @@ public class LimitRecordBatch extends 
AbstractSingleRecordBatch<Limit> {
   @Override
   protected void setupNewSchema() throws SchemaChangeException {
     container.clear();
+    transfers.clear();
 
 
     for(VectorWrapper<?> v : incoming){

Reply via email to